- Working as part of a team, you will provide an efficient and friendly service to customers, assisting as directed with all aspects of food preparation and presentation to high quality standards.
- Comply with all HACCP (Hazard analysis of critical control points) regulations as necessary and all Health, Safety & Hygiene standards
- Maintain a hygienic and tidy environment; ensure tables, accompaniments and counters are kept clean and adequately supplied throughout the service period.
- Check deliveries and food temperatures, completing records and operating the till as required.
- Report defective equipment/ utensils/ work and floor surfaces or any other Health and Safety issues etc. to your Line Manager
